草庐IT

html5-data

全部标签

php - 使用 SwiftMailer 的 text/html 和 text/plain 附件

我正在使用swiftmailer到发送电子邮件,我希望有相同的附件:*HTML版本(text/html)作为内联图像(cid)*文本版本(text/plain)作为附件我正在Ubuntu上使用MozillaThunderbird45.3.0测试电子邮件。我一直在研究->setBody、->addPart、->embed和->attach方法,但我总是破坏其中一个版本(即,我以HTML或文本格式查看邮件,以纯文本格式获取电子邮件)。我的测试代码看起来像(当然有有效的SMTP地址和文件路径):functionswiftMail(){require_once'./vendor/swiftma

php - 当使用 PHP 选择值 'other' 时如何显示 HTML 输入字段

我想弄清楚的是,当从下拉菜单中选择other的值时,如何让htmlinput字段出现。现在,下拉列表的值来自MySQLDB查询的结果,该查询有效,但我似乎无法弄清楚如何在选择其他选项时显示输入。$query=mysql_query("SELECTtypeFROMDropdown_Service_Type");//Runyourqueryecho'';//Openyourdropdownboxecho'';//Loopthroughthequeryresults,outputingtheoptionsonebyonewhile($row=mysql_fetch_array($query)

php - 如何使用 phpmailer 并从 ckeditor 以 html 格式发送邮件

我正在使用phpmailer发送电子邮件,在表单ckeditor上插入html代码的内容时遇到问题,但数据仅发送到电子邮件文本。这是我的代码:require_once('class.phpmailer.php');$mail=newPHPMailer(true);if(isset($_POST['btn_send'])){$smtp_username=strip_tags($_POST['username']);$smtp_password=strip_tags($_POST['password']);$ssl_port=strip_tags($_POST['port']);$my_s

php - 从 PHP 数组中仅输出括号中不包含 HTML 标记的值

这是一个示例PHP数组,很好地解释了我的问题$array=array('1'=>'CookieMonster(eatscookies)','2'=>'Tiger(eatsmeat)','3'=>'Muzzy(eatsclocks)','4'=>'Cow(eatsgrass)');我只需要从这个数组中返回不包含任何用括号括起来的标签的值:-Tiger(eatsmeat)-Cow(eatsgrass)为此,我将使用以下代码:$array_no_tags=preg_grep("/[A-Za-z]\s\(^((?!(.*?)).)*$\)/",$array);foreach($array_no

php - 保存在 Opencart 模块后,我的 HTML 内容消失了

我最近在学习opencart应用程序。当我使用opencart模块向我的主页添加一些内容时,它消失了。但是如果我放一些普通的文字,我不会遇到任何问题。但是当我把一些HTML内容和文本放在一起时,它就消失了。我不知道我的错误在哪里,我该如何解决?谁能帮帮我?当我写正常文本时没有问题在多个DIV或标签中写入文本时出现问题注意:我使用的是Opencart默认子主题。 最佳答案 这是您的解决方案:将html内容放入代码编辑器后,您必须再次单击进入文本模式。然后保存它...您的问题将得到解决。 关

PHP MVC : Data Mapper pattern: class design

我有一个带有域对象和数据映射器的WebMVC应用程序。数据映射器的类方法包含所有数据库查询逻辑。我试图避免镜像任何数据库结构,因此,在构建sql语句时实现最大的灵active。因此,原则上,我尽量不使用任何ORM或ActiveRecord结构/模式。举个例子:通常,我可以有一个抽象类AbstractDataMapper由所有特定数据映射器类继承-如UserDataMapper类。然后我可以在AbstractDataMapper中定义一个findById()方法,通过给定的id值,例如用户身份。但这意味着我总是从单个表中获取记录,而不可能使用任何左连接来从对应于给定id-用户id的其他一

php - 正则表达式:如何不替换任何 html 标签中的特定单词?

让我们假设我有这样一段文字:Thisisagreattest!We'retestingsomethingawesome.Clickheretotestit!.我想给“test”这个词添加一些颜色,但如果它在a标签中则不行。我试过这样做:/(?)test/但它不起作用。它是这样工作的:/(?)test/当然我有很多链接,所以这不是一个选项。整个代码应该是这样的:$replacement=preg_replace('/(?)test/','test',$replacement);预期结果:Thisisagreattest!We'retestingsomethingawesome.Click

php - angularjs 4 : how to post raw JSON data

我想向我的phpapi发送以下请求:POST/MyProject/api-get?call=get-accountHTTP/1.1Host:localhost{"id":1}这是API:publicfunctionactionApiGet($call){$data=json_decode(file_get_contents('php://input'),true);...}我的组件.ts:import{Component}from'@angular/core';import{Router}from'@angular/router';import{ActivatedRoute}from'

javascript - 在html中使用放大镜将鼠标悬停在图像上

我使用以下说明在我的网页中为图像添加了一个放大镜:https://www.w3schools.com/howto/howto_js_image_magnifier_glass.asp即使鼠标不在放大框上,放大框也会停留在图像上。我怎样才能修改为只有当鼠标悬停在放大镜上时才会出现放大镜?谢谢, 最佳答案 您可以使用悬停在CSS中完成这一切,无需javascript从下面复制样式表。*{box-sizing:border-box;}.img-magnifier-container{position:relative;cursor:non

php - 来自 value API 的 HTML 星级

有一个挑战,自从我使用HTML和PHP以来已经很久了。从第3方客户反馈工具,他们提供了一个API。幸福值很容易从API中提取,并以百分比显示。仅此而已..我想知道并尝试通过将PHP包含到文档中来实现这一点,并制作一个更加丰富多彩和可见的View。例如;http://jsfiddle.net/b6tqtaLn/1/Star-ratingwithcss将百分比(例如来自API的95%)转换为在星标中可见的值的最佳方法是什么?提前致谢! 最佳答案 首先,您需要定义将使用多少(最大)星星。例如,如果您从API收到的最大值是100%,并且您使